数据库设计说明书编写规范
1.引言
在引言部分,需要对数据库设计说明书进行简要介绍,包括项目背景、目的和范围等。同时,在引言中还需对数据库设计的基本原则和设计思路进行阐述,以帮助读者更好地理解和使用数据库。
2.数据库设计目标
在数据库设计目标部分,明确数据库设计的目标和要达到的效果。例如,提高数据存取效率、减少数据冗余、保证数据一致性等。同时,还需说明数据库设计的业务需求和用户需求,以确保数据库设计满足实际需求。
3.数据库设计需求分析
在数据库设计需求分析部分,对数据库设计的需求进行详细的分析和说明。主要包括数据量估计、数据类型、数据关系、数据完整性、安全性等方面的需求。此外,还需分析用户的查询需求和业务操作需求,以确保数据库设计满足用户需求。
数据库设计说明书的目的
4.数据库设计方法与过程
在数据库设计方法与过程部分,详细描述数据库设计的方法和过程。首先,对数据库设计的整体流程进行说明,包括需求分析、概念设计、逻辑设计、物理设计等阶段。然后,对每个阶段的具体方法和步骤进行描述,包括使用的工具和技术。
5.数据库结构设计
在数据库结构设计部分,详细描述数据库的架构、模型和表结构。首先,对数据库的整体架构进行描述,包括数据库管理系统的选择、数据库服务器的配置等。然后,对数据库的模型进行描述,包括概念模型、逻辑模型和物理模型。最后,对数据库的表结构进行描述,包括表的定义、字段定义、约束条件等。
6.数据库性能优化策略
在数据库性能优化策略部分,详细描述如何优化数据库的性能,以提高查询效率和响应速度。主要包括索引的设计、查询语句的优化、物理存储结构的调整等方面。此外,还需说明如何监控和调整数据库的性能,以及如何解决性能问题和故障。
7.数据库备份与恢复策略
在数据库备份与恢复策略部分,详细说明如何进行数据库的备份和恢复。主要包括备份频率、备份方式、备份目标、恢复方式等方面。此外,还需说明如何验证备份的完整性和正确性,以确保备份数据的可用性和可靠性。
8.数据库安全策略
在数据库安全策略部分,详细说明如何保护数据库的安全性和机密性。主要包括用户管理、权限管理、审计日志、访问控制等方面。此外,还需说明如何应对安全威胁和攻击,以及如何进行数据库的数据加密和解密。
9.数据库设计实现
在数据库设计实现部分,对数据库设计的具体实现进行说明。主要包括数据库的创建、表的创建、索引的创建等方面。此外,还需说明如何进行数据库的初始化和数据迁移操作,以及如何进行数据库的测试和验证。
10.结束语
在结束语部分,对整个数据库设计说明书进行总结和回顾。同时,还需对未来可能的改进和拓展进行展望,以为数据库的持续发展和优化提供参考。
编写数据库设计说明书时需要尽量遵守上述规范,以确保说明书的完整性、准确性和可读性。同时,还需根据具体项目需求灵活运用,以满足实际情况。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。